_, _ = fmt.Fprintf(f, `<html><head><title>epoint-server submit form</title></head><body>
<h2>epoint-server submit form</h2>
<h3>web form</h3>
-<p>submit one document at once
-<form method="post" action="http://localhost%s/submit">
+<p>submit one document at a time
+<form method="post" action="/submit">
<p>key:<br><textarea name="key" rows="5" cols="80"></textarea>
<p>draft:<br><textarea name="draft" rows="5" cols="80"></textarea>
<p>debit:<br><textarea name="debit" rows="5" cols="80"></textarea>
</pre>
where 'name' is 'key', 'draft' or 'debit'.
</body></html>
-`, addr)
+`)
_ = f.Close()
// queries
}
draft, ok := iv.(*document.Draft)
if !ok {
- err = fmt.Errorf("ParseDraft: expected a draft docuent")
+ err = fmt.Errorf("ParseDraft: expected a draft document")
return
}
draftid = document.Id(signed)
if err != nil {
// first cert: drawer is issuer
if draft.Drawer != draft.Issuer {
- return nil, fmt.Errorf("drawer must be the issuer when drawing an empty account")
+ return nil, fmt.Errorf("drawer must be the issuer when drawing an empty account (%s != %s)", draft.Drawer, draft.Issuer)
}
cert.Serial = 1
cert.Balance = cert.Difference